To model a galley kitchen in ArchiMaster 3D, draw the room shell to finished interior dimensions, place base cabinets at a true 24-inch depth, set countertops with a 1 to 1.5 inch front overhang, and then check the remaining aisle between counter edges with the dimension tool. A workable galley needs at least 42 inches between opposing counters for one cook and 48 inches for two cooks. The model becomes the contract drawing: if a cabinet depth or overhang is wrong in 3D, the fabricated countertop and appliance fit will be wrong in the room. This workflow avoids the most common galley mistake, which is measuring cabinet face to cabinet face and forgetting that countertops and door swings consume aisle space. Draw the Room Shell from Finished Faces, Not Framing

In ArchiMaster 3D, start a new plan and draw the galley by its interior finished dimensions. A 96-inch-wide room is not a 96-inch kitchen: two 2x4 stud walls with drywall remove about 9 inches, leaving a finished 87-inch interior. Set the wall assembly first, using 4.5 inches for 2x4 framing with half-inch drywall or 6.5 inches for 2x6 framing, because cabinet backs sit against drywall, not studs. Place a temporary dimension from finished wall to finished wall and lock that distance before any cabinet enters the model.

Wall thickness changes the clearance math more than most remodelers expect. A 60-inch-wide exterior room with two 4.5-inch wall assemblies leaves only 51 inches of clear interior space. Set 24-inch base cabinets on both sides, and the gap between cabinet faces is just 3 inches. Countertop overhang will reduce that further, which is why the countertop slab is modeled separately. Draw the shell once and avoid changing wall thickness after cabinets are placed; moving a wall can silently detach cabinet backs and erase the precise clearance you just checked.

Place Base Cabinets at a Real 24-Inch Depth

Open the cabinetry library in ArchiMaster 3D and place a base cabinet along one long wall. Set the base cabinet depth to 24 inches, the North American standard, and set its width and height to match the run: 30, 33, or 36 inch widths are common, with a 34.5 inch cabinet height plus countertop. Align the back of the cabinet to the drywall face. Do not leave a hidden half-inch void behind the cabinet; the void creates a false dimension and does not add useful clearance.

If the galley has a corner, model a blind corner cabinet or a lazy Susan unit at its true 36 by 36 inch footprint. A compact galley often fails because the corner cabinet was drawn as a simple rectangle, which understates the space the door and rotating shelf need. Place sink and range cabinets after the corner is set so the countertop seam and plumbing rough-in land in real positions, not where the drawing was convenient.

Model the Countertop Overhang as a Separate Slab

In ArchiMaster 3D, model countertops as a slab on top of the cabinet run rather than resizing the cabinet box. Standard countertop depth is 25 to 25.5 inches on a 24-inch base cabinet, giving a 1 to 1.5 inch front overhang. The back edge sits flush to the wall or leaves a one-eighth-inch scribe gap for fabrication tolerance. Select the slab and set its depth to the true countertop depth, then confirm the front edge extends past the cabinet face. For a galley, this overhang is not decorative: a 1.5-inch overhang on each side of a 48-inch aisle reduces usable walkway to 45 inches. Check the gap between the two countertop front edges, not the cabinet faces.

The countertop slab also lets you model an integrated backsplash and a mitered return at the galley end. If the run terminates at a wall or doorway, set the slab to stop one-eighth-inch short of the obstruction. This tolerance is what a fabricator will cut anyway, and seeing it in 3D prevents a surprise gap at the wall. Set the Aisle and Door Swing Clearances

After the cabinets and countertop slabs are in place, measure the working aisle between the two counter front edges. The National Kitchen and Bath Association guideline is 42 inches for a single cook and 48 inches for multiple cooks in a galley. Apply that dimension to the path where the cook stands and turns, not just the centerline. If the aisle is narrower, reduce cabinet depth on one side to 21 or 18 inches for a shallow pantry run. Model appliances as full-depth blocks with door swings, because a dishwasher door can consume 27 inches of a 42-inch aisle. Place the dishwasher perpendicular to the aisle and open its door in the 3D view to confirm a person can stand at the sink while the door is down. Do the same for the oven door, the refrigerator doors, and any tall pantry pull-outs. The non-obvious tradeoff is that a 36-inch refrigerator with a 32-inch door swing can block the main corridor even when the counter-to-counter dimension passes the 42-inch rule.

  • Measure counter edge to counter edge, not cabinet face to cabinet face.
  • Confirm 42 inches for one cook, 48 inches for two cooks in the work zone.
  • Open every appliance door in the 3D model and check standing room.
  • Keep the primary work aisle free of open door swings and pull-out hardware.
  • Add 3 inches to a corner cabinet footprint for door clearance.

Export a Dimensioned Plan for the Cabinetmaker and Countertop Fabricator

Before ordering cabinets or stone, export the dimensioned plan. In ArchiMaster 3D, use the dimension tool to place finished-face measurements on the plan: wall-to-wall width, cabinet run length, countertop depth including overhang, and the clear aisle dimension. Export as a PDF or image and send the same file to the cabinetmaker and countertop fabricator. A 24-inch base cabinet with a 25.5-inch countertop slab looks correct only if both trades read the same finished-face dimensions. If the plan shows face-to-face cabinet dimensions instead, the fabricator will cut a countertop too shallow for the overhang you modeled.

The exported plan also becomes the punch list for installation day. Mark the location of plumbing rough-ins, the dishwasher electrical outlet, and any wall sconce boxes that conflict with tall cabinets. Check the elevation view for crown molding clearance and under-cabinet task lighting placement. A galley is a narrow room, so an error of one inch in cabinet depth shifts the entire work aisle. Common questions
What is the minimum clearance for a galley kitchen in 3D?
Model at least 42 inches between counter edges for one cook and 48 inches for multiple cooks. Include cabinet depth, countertop overhang, and open appliance door swings in the measurement.
How deep are standard galley kitchen base cabinets?
Standard base cabinets are 24 inches deep. Countertops run 25 to 25.5 inches deep, which includes a 1 to 1.5 inch front overhang. A shallow pantry run can use 18 or 21 inch deep cabinets.
Should countertop overhang be included in galley aisle clearance?
Yes. A 1.5-inch overhang on each side reduces a 48-inch aisle to 45 inches. Always measure between the two countertop front edges, not the cabinet faces.

How do I model an appliance door swing in a galley kitchen?
Place the appliance as a full-depth block and open its door in the 3D view. Confirm a person can stand at the sink or walk past while the door is open, then adjust the aisle or cabinet depth if needed.
